Coast district group created

Five Newport-Mesa residents have been appointed to the Coast

Community College District’s Measure C Citizen’s Oversight Committee.

The group will ensure that the bond’s $370 million are spent as

the public voted in November and that the district complies with all

legal requirements.

Katrina Foley, Jim Garmon and Ron Linksy of Costa Mesa, John

Lindgren of Corona del Mar and Lisa Silbar of Newport Beach were

among the nine people appointed to the committee. They will first

meet at the end of the month.

The Measure C funds are expected to alleviate overcrowding through

expansion and upgrade aging facilities. One of the first projects

will be a new transportation center building at Orange Coast College.

Church will host unity event

Harbor Christian Church in Newport Beach will host Visions of

Unity, a one-day seminar that will discuss peaceful coexistence of

different cultures and religions.

The free event, from 10 a.m. and 2 p.m. Saturday, will feature

speakers and spiritual leaders of different faiths. Participants will

also engage in small group discussions.

Lunch and a musical performance are included. Donations will be

accepted.
